Understanding the Source of Pet Odors
Eliminating pet odors begins with understanding why they persist. Unlike simple surface dirt, pet smells are often embedded in porous materials like carpets, upholstery, and drywall. Urine, in particular, penetrates deep into padding and subfloors, creating a breeding ground for bacteria that continue to produce ammonia and mercaptans long after the initial accident. Saliva and skin oils (dander) embed in fabrics and contribute to a stale, musty undertone that standard sweeping cannot reach. Identifying the specific source—whether it's a fresh accident or old, dried-in residue—is the first step toward truly eliminating pet odors.

The Science of Pet Urine and Enzymatic Cleaning
When pet urine dries, it leaves behind uric acid crystals that are resistant to water and traditional cleaners. These crystals re-activate with humidity, causing odors to return even after a surface wipe. Enzymatic cleaners are the gold standard for eliminating pet odors because they contain live microorganisms that digest these crystals at a biological level. The enzymes break down the uric acid into harmless gases and water. For best results, apply the enzymatic solution generously, ensuring it penetrates to the backing of the carpet or into the foam of a couch cushion. Allow it to air dry undisturbed; the microbes need time to consume the odor source completely.
Surface Cleaning vs. Deep Extraction
A quick wipe-down addresses airborne smells but fails to remove embedded odor. Deep extraction, often performed with a wet vacuum or steam cleaner, pulls contaminants out of the material rather than pushing them deeper. When tackling pet odors, use cold water for fresh urine (hot water sets protein stains) and warm water for older, general odors. Always blot rather than rub, which spreads the liquid. After extraction, a fan or dehumidifier speeds drying and prevents mold, which can create a secondary, musty pet smell.
DIY Solutions for Immediate Relief
- Baking Soda: Liberally sprinkle on dry carpets or pet bedding; let sit for 15 minutes before vacuuming. It absorbs surface moisture and neutralizes acidic odor molecules.
- White Vinegar Solution: Mix one part white vinegar with one part water in a spray bottle. Mist on affected areas (test on a hidden spot first); the acetic acid neutralizes alkaline urine odors.
- Hydrogen Peroxide: A 3% solution can break down odor-causing compounds on hard floors, but it may bleach some fabrics.
Preventing Odors Before They Start
The most effective way to eliminate pet odors is to prevent them from settling. Establish a strict cleaning routine: rinse food bowls daily, wash pet bedding weekly in hot water, and vacuum high-traffic areas frequently using a HEPA filter vacuum that captures dander. For cats, maintain a strict litter box schedule—scoop daily and replace litter entirely every two weeks. Wash the box itself with soap and water monthly, as residual scent attracts cats back to the same spot and can spread odor to the surrounding floor.
Air Filtration and Ventilation
Activated carbon air purifiers trap odor molecules that mechanical filters miss. Place units in rooms where pets sleep or where accidents commonly occur. Increasing ventilation by opening windows or running HVAC systems with fresh air intake dilutes indoor pet odors and reduces the concentration of allergens that often accompany them.
When to Call a Professional
Some pet odors are beyond DIY treatment. If an accident has soaked through to the subfloor or if a persistent musty smell lingers despite cleaning, the odor may be harbored inside walls or beneath the foundation. Professional restoration companies use thermal imaging to locate moisture pockets and commercial-grade ozone generators to oxidize deeply embedded odor molecules. This is also necessary when pets mark vertical surfaces like walls or baseboards, where the residue is nearly impossible to reach with household tools.
Addressing Odors on Hard Surfaces and Fabrics
Hardwood floors and tile grout require different tactics than soft surfaces. On hardwood, wipe accidents immediately with an enzymatic cleaner; avoid ammonia-based products, which mimic the scent of urine and can encourage repeat marking. For upholstery, remove cushions and treat the underlying fabric with an enzyme spray. For pet beds and removable covers, wash in the hottest water the fabric allows and add a cup of white vinegar to the rinse cycle to break down residual oils.
Conclusion
Eliminating pet odors effectively requires targeting the source biologically rather than masking it with fragrances. A combination of enzymatic digestion, deep extraction, and consistent prevention keeps a home smelling clean even with multiple pets. Patience is essential—some old odors may require repeated treatments—but with the right approach, a truly fresh environment is achievable.
